Freescale KITFXLC95000EVM
тел. +7(499)347-04-82
Описание Freescale KITFXLC95000EVM
Конечно, вот подробное описание, технические характеристики и информация о совместимости для оценочной платы Freescale KITFXLC95000EVM.
Описание
Freescale KITFXLC95000EVM — это оценочная (отладочная) плата, разработанная компанией Freescale Semiconductor (ныне NXP Semiconductors) для демонстрации возможностей и упрощения разработки на 32-битном микроконтроллере серии Kinetis FXLC95000.
Этот МК относится к семейству Kinetis L-серии, которое базируется на энергоэффективном ядре ARM Cortex-M0+. Ключевая особенность серии FXLC95000 — интегрированный контроллер ЖК-дисплея (LCD) с поддержкой до 8x40 сегментов (или различных других конфигураций, например, 4x44, 6x42), что делает его идеальным решением для приложений с простыми графическими или символьными индикаторами: бытовая техника, медицинские приборы, промышленные панели управления, термостаты, измерительное оборудование.
Плата EVM предоставляет разработчику все необходимое для начала работы:
- Полный доступ к выводам микроконтроллера.
- Встроенный отладчик/программатор (OSBDM или OpenSDA).
- ЖК-дисплей для демонстрации возможностей LCD-контроллера.
- Комплект периферии: светодиоды, кнопки, потенциометр, разъемы расширения.
- Подключение к ПК через USB для питания, программирования и отладки.
Технические характеристики
1. Основной микроконтроллер:
- Модель: MKL05Z32VFM4 (наиболее распространенная на этой плате).
- Ядро: ARM Cortex-M0+.
- Тактовая частота: До 48 МГц.
- Флэш-память: 32 КБ.
- ОЗУ (SRAM): 4 КБ.
- Ключевая особенность: LCD-контроллер с поддержкой до 8x40 сегментов, встроенный драйвер (напряжение генерируется на кристалле).
2. Периферия на плате:
- ЖК-дисплей: Сегментный индикатор для демонстрации работы (обычно 4-6 сегментов, активируемых перемычками).
- Интерфейсы отладки и связи:
- OpenSDA / OSBDM: Универсальный отладчик и виртуальный COM-порт (USB).
- Разъемы для внешнего программатора (10-контактный ARM Cortex Debug).
- Органы управления: Кнопки сброса и пользовательская кнопка.
- Индикация: Светодиоды питания и пользовательские светодиоды.
- Аналоговый интерфейс: Потенциометр (подключен к АЦП).
- Разъемы расширения: Выводы всех сигналов МК на краевые разъемы (обычно в формате Arduino R3).
- Питание: Через USB-порт Micro-B или от внешнего источника.
3. Программное обеспечение и экосистема:
- Поддерживаемые IDE: NXP Kinetis Design Studio (KDS), IAR Embedded Workbench, Keil MDK, MCUXpresso IDE.
- Пакеты SDK: Код примеров и драйверы доступны через MCUXpresso SDK (для процессоров Kinetis) или в составе старых пакетов Freescale.
Парт-номера и совместимые модели
1. Основной парт-номер оценочной платы:
- KITFXLC95000EVM — полное официальное название.
2. Совместимые микроконтроллеры серии Kinetis FXLC95000: Плата предназначена для оценки всей подсерии, хотя оснащена конкретным чипом. Разработка возможна для следующих МК (отличающихся объемом памяти и набором корпусов):
- MKL05Z32xxx4 (32 КБ флэш, 4 КБ ОЗУ, QFN-32) — установлен на плате.
- MKL05Z16xxx4 (16 КБ флэш, 2 КБ ОЗУ, QFN-32).
- MKL05Z8xxx4 (8 КБ флэш, 1 КБ ОЗУ, QFN-32).
- MKL05Z32xxx2 (32 КБ флэш, 4 КБ ОЗУ, TSSOP-20) — без LCD-выводов.
- MKL05Z16xxx2 (16 КБ флэш, 2 КБ ОЗУ, TSSOP-20) — без LCD-выводов.
3. Совместимые оценочные и отладочные платы (аналогичного назначения):
- FRDM-KL05Z (Freedom Board) — более простая и дешевая плата форм-фактора Arduino R3 на том же МК MKL05Z32VFM4, но без ЖК-дисплея. Является логической альтернативой для проектов без LCD.
- FRDM-KL46Z — плата на более продвинутом МК KL46 (Cortex-M0+ с USB и большей памятью), также имеет сегментный ЖК-дисплей.
4. Совместимые отладчики:
- Встроенный интерфейс OpenSDA можно обновить/заменить на firmware от P&E Micro, Segger J-Link (требует аппаратной модификации) или использовать стандартный CMSIS-DAP.
- Можно подключить внешний отладчик через 10-контактный разъем: J-Link, ULINK2, P&E Micro Cyclone.
Ключевые области применения
- Разработка устройств с сегментными ЖК-индикаторами.
- Оценка энергопотребления ядра Cortex-M0+.
- Прототипирование устройств для "умного" дома, IoT (без радиомодуля), промышленной и бытовой автоматики.
- Обучение программированию микроконтроллеров ARM.
Примечание: Поскольку плата и серия МК уже не являются новыми (производство продолжается, но акцент смещен на более новые серии NXP), актуальное программное обеспечение и драйверы рекомендуется искать через MCUXpresso IDE и MCUXpresso SDK Config Tools на официальном сайте NXP.